Dynamics GP Professional 9.00.365
Integration Manager 9.00.0047

We have a few users that need to use Direct to Table imports in Integration Manager. We set the integrations up on one of our IT dept computers and everything works fine. The same integration fails on the end user workstation.

The error reads:
Code:
Integration '_integrationname' is not ready to run due to the following problems:

Not able to get the moniker of the object
Could not open DSN 'IM_DSN'.
Error was:

'[Microsoft][ODBC QL Server Driver][SQL Server]Login failed for user '(null)'. Reason: Not associated with a trusted SQL Server connection.'

I have verified the setup of the SQL system DSN on the worksation as well as uninstalled/reinstalled the direct to table connector within IM. The integration fails even when we logon to the end user's pc as one of the IT accounts (both within the AD and within GP).

Any ideas?

Try setting up the DSN using the "sa" login. I hope you have set it up using system DSN and not User DSN. Also, You must be using SQL server authentication. For Direct to Table Imports, if the COM+ account credentials with which the initial installation was done are changed then also you'll have problems.
